Output ef1d81a085ed22d89dec610d4cb95093c8fe6f9230c91192506c61d254b9620f:0

value
12678205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4742e7775b3ae342de5a4b6edeb2b98cc91dc4e3 OP_EQUAL
address
38Bp3kFngCG1E6F4NTk3YTxN1YaZedWfJF
transaction
ef1d81a085ed22d89dec610d4cb95093c8fe6f9230c91192506c61d254b9620f
confirmations
273801
spent
true